Paper sculptors are artists-in-residence

Paper sculptors Allen and Patty Eckman are serving as the 2011 Elizabeth Rubendall Artists-in-Residence, through May 1, at the Great Plains Art Museum. Visitors can watch and interact with the Eckmans as they work. There are also hands-on stations for visitors to experiment with cast paper. Continue reading…
